Record high employment in the second quarter of 2017 was reported by the Bulgarian Ministry of the Economy. According to the data, employment reaches 71% and the number of employed is 3,200,000 people.
In the second quarter of the year, unemployment dropped to 6.3% and the number of unemployed is over 200,000 people.
For the same period, the wages increased by nearly 10%, according to the ministry. Main reason for growth in the country is the increase in value added coming from the industry.
